One of my favorite stories of film trivia pertains to the Hammer Films version of The Mummy. The scene called for the mummy, played by Christopher Lee, to knock a door off its hinges to enter a room and attack Peter Cushing's character. The door in question was on its hinges, minus the bolts so that it would just fly off the hinges when Lee hit it. That was the idea. But a grip inadvertently put bolts in place, thinking "That door's gonna fall off its hinges." Lee did knock the door down, but dislocated his shoulder in the process. The shot remains in the film.
